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Angular angel shark | Hourglass Dolphin |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Elasmobranchii |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Squatiniformes (Squatiniformes) |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) |
| Family | Squatinidae |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ins) |
| Genus | Squatina | Lagenorhynchus |
| Species | Squatina guggenheim | Lagenorhynchus cruciger |
Evolutionary Relationship
Angular angel shark and Hourglass Dolphin share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
